London Street Pancras International, Euston Road, London
Open: 6:30 am - 9:00 pm5.84 mi 149 Central Road, Worcester Park
Open: 7:30 am - 6:00 pm5.84 mi West Middlesex Hospital, Isleworth
Open: 7:30 am - 7:30 pm5.86 mi 99 Gresham Street, City of London, London
closed5.87 mi West Side, Kings Cross Station, Pancras Road, Kings Cross, London
Open: 6:00 am - 9:00 pm5.87 mi 92 South Ealing Road, South Ealing, London
Open: 7:00 am - 7:00 pm5.88 mi